CEMEX Ventures has now announced its list of top 50 high-performing startups in the ConTech (construction technology) ecosystem. They included aspiring organizations from the categories green construction technology, construction supply chain, enhanced construction productivity, and ConTech startups with the future in mind.
Who is CEMEX Ventures?
CEMEX, the Mexican multinational building materials company, headquartered in San Pedro, near Monterrey, was ranked as one of the world’s fifth-largest of such providers. Cement, ready-mix concrete, and aggregates are some products it manufactures which have been distributed across more than 50 countries – including the United States.

CEMEX Ventures is their venture capital unit with the objective to invest in promising ConTech startups and support them with an ecosystem to thrive and accelerate their growth beyond what they could achieve on their own. On their website their describe themselves to be “fostering the construction revolution by engaging with startups, entrepreneurs, universities and other stakeholders in the industry.”
What is a ConTech startup?
What does ConTech even mean? It’s a buzzword for construction technology in short. Similar to how MarTech means marketing technology and FinTech means financial technology. Of course this means that they have to provide more than a software for construction project management and the likes.

CEMEX Ventures states that they considered ConTech startups in their list which obtained relevant investments rounds or brought the construction industry closer to a more sustainable, productive, and technological environment in the last year.
50 most promising startups of 2021 leading the ConTech ecosystem
So, without further ado, you can now have a look at the latest Top 50 list of ConTech startups as per the CEMEX Ventures list. The table below is not a ranking itself, the order of startups shown is following an alphabetical order.
Startup | Description | Country |
AI Clearing | Digital project progress reporting SaaS platform that integrates several data sources to offer fully automated insights for infrastructure & energy. | United States |
Apellix | Aerial robotics company, creating computer-controlled UAVs to perform the dirty and dangerous work required for infrastructure construction and maintenance. | United States |
ATLAS Group | AI-powered data platform and search engine for the construction sector. | United Kingdom |
bex technologies | Last-mile delivery and logistics platform for the construction industry. | Germany |
BRC Swiss | Pile-head cutting problem solution that uses revolutionary new technology. | Switzerland |
Carbix | Transforming CO2 into building materials. | United States |
Ception | AI-powered system for mobile heavy equipment that improves safety, productivity, and sustainability. | Israel |
Circularise | A blockchain-enabled platform that traces materials and products to verify the origins, certificates, CO2 footprint, and other material data throughout their whole supply chain. | The Netherlands |
Concular | Recirculation of construction material through AI-based matching and GHG measurement with a life cycle assessment. | Germany |
Conxai Technologies | No-Code AI to accelerate the digital transformation in the AEC industry. | Germany |
Cosuno | Cloud-based software that streamlines the bidding and tendering processes of any construction project. | Germany |
Cover | Developers of the first custom home building process that can scale to solve the housing crisis. | United States |
CRDC | Fine synthetic aggregate product lines to create a zero-waste and emissions reduced symbiosis between advanced waste plastic management and the entire scope of the concrete industry. | Costa Rica |
Cuby Technologies | Onsite mini-factories for better building construction. | United States |
Document Crunch | A web-based platform that immediately finds and provides important provisions in contracts and other documents, saving time and money while making the industry smarter and better able to manage construction projects. | United States |
Eiravato | Systemic software solution enabling the commercially driven transformation of waste into resources. | Ireland |
GAUSS Control | A holistic solution to predict and reduce accidents in risky operations. | Chile |
GoContractor | Online subcontractor onboarding and safety management platform. | Ireland |
HiiRoc | Step-change technology for low-cost, zero-emission hydrogen production. | United Kingdom |
Hovering Solutions | Autonomous flying drones for underground and indoor inspections, capable of flying without GPS or any radio signal, generating a 3D model of the infrastructure. | Spain |
hyperTunnel | InfraTech startup with a patented process to build, repair and expand tunnels for transportation, utilities, mining, and underground assets. | United Kingdom |
InnoCSR | Disruptive material technology company producing Soil Stabilizer that binds soil and cement together. | South Korea |
InStock | Collaborative platform to track all construction products in real-time. | India |
JustManage | Automated construction scheduling | Israel |
Madaster | Disruptive online cloud platform providing a one-stop access point to leverage materials and property data. | The Netherlands |
Mastt | ConTech SaaS solution that helps building & infrastructure owners make faster project decisions, preventing cost and time blowouts, and stopping risks before they occur. | Australia |
Minolite | Transforming glass waste into sustainable construction materials | Switzerland |
Module | Building the future of attainable housing with better products and processes. | United States |
Modulize | Offsite construction (OSC) platform powered by calculation and design automation. | Norway |
Nodes & Links | AI-based platform to create smart machines to automate project management. | United Kingdom |
PartRunner | Last-mile deliveries for the “big & bulky”. | United States |
PLINX | Safety system designed to make construction sites smarter and safer. | United Kingdom |
ProcurePro | Digital procurement & subcontract management software for contractors that increases quality, efficiencies, and profitability. | Australia |
QuoteToMe | A solution that digitizes the procure-pay workflow for building materials, equipment, and site services. | Canada |
RatedPower | Automation optimization of the study, analysis, design, and engineering of photovoltaic plants in all its stages. | Spain |
Rockease | B2B marketplace and digital tools to procure and deliver aggregates for construction professionals. | France |
Ruedata | Machine learning solution to reduce tire expenses and CO2 emissions for fleet vehicles. | Mexico |
SafeAI Inc | Global autonomous heavy equipment leader focused on transforming existing heavy industry machines into self-operating robotic assets. | United States |
SiteHive | Real-time environmental management for today’s world, providing an integrated hardware and software solution for the proactive management of environmental impact. | Australia |
SkyMul | Modular robots to accelerate construction with nimbleness and scalability. | United States |
SMART CAST | A disruptive off-site construction method for MEP integration in concrete slabs. | France |
StructShare | Infield procurement and material management solution purpose-built for specialty contractors. | Israel / USA |
Synhelion | Synhelion produces solar fuels to decarbonize industries. | Switzerland |
Tellux | Artificial Intelligence and hyperspectral imaging for analyzing polluted soils. | France |
The Building Machines Company | Additive manufacturing technology that uses a robotic system to improve the creation of solid precast concrete structures and their components. | United States |
ThroughPut | AI orchestration software that enables teams to leverage existing industrial data systems across the entire end-to-end supply chain. | United States |
Trusstor | Data-driven SaaS solution for the construction industry that helps enhance site efficiency and safety, increasing profit margins and savings. | Israel |
Unilite | Patented recycling technologies that turn multiple waste streams into high-performance lightweight aggregate. | Taiwan |
WASTEBOX | Waste management platform that connects construction companies directly with haulers and disposal sites. | Austria |
Yardlink | Procurement platform to digitize the construction supply chain. | United Kingdom |
Remarks and comments from the leadership of CEMEX Ventures
In addition to disclosing this list of top-ranking startups in the construction industry, Gonzalo Galindo, head of CEMEX Ventures, shares, “As we predicted last year, sustainable solutions saw a spike in investment from leading companies and investors. We will continue seeing this trend in 2022, as well as more companies betting on solutions that help deal with the supply chain hurdles that the industry is experiencing. Supply chain management had been struggling pre-pandemic and with COVID-19, the challenges increased”
